What is Phototoxic Dermatitis?

A non-immune skin reaction occurring when a photosensitizing chemical (applied to the skin or taken internally) absorbs UV light and causes direct cellular damage, producing an exaggerated sunburn in exposed areas. Common culprits include doxycycline, NSAIDs, and certain plants.

What does 'photo' mean in 'phototoxic'?

+
'Photo' comes from Greek and means 'light.' Whenever you see 'photo' in a medical word, it has something to do with light or how light affects the body. That's why this condition involves a reaction triggered by sunlight.

What does 'toxic' mean in 'phototoxic'?

+
'Toxic' means poisonous or harmful. In this word, it tells you that light is causing direct damage to skin cells. So 'phototoxic' literally means 'poisoned by light.'

What does 'dermatitis' mean?

+
'Dermatitis' is made up of 'derm' (meaning skin) and 'itis' (meaning inflammation). So dermatitis just means skin inflammation or irritation. You'll hear 'dermatitis' used in many skin condition names.

What's a simple way to explain what 'phototoxic dermatitis' means?

+
In everyday language, it's a skin reaction that happens when certain substances on or in your body react badly with sunlight and cause skin damage. Think of it as an extreme sunburn triggered by a chemical plus UV light together.
